Fora urge removal of RTI Commissioner

Last Updated 07 September 2011, 16:34 IST

The rally was inaugurated by former speaker Krishna at the Kote Anajaneya Swamy temple here on Wednesday.

Speaking on the occasion, he said Karnataka Public Service Commission (KPSC) has become a matrimonial centre.

Irregularities

Instead of giving priority to meritorious candidates, posts are being given to those with money power. The Right to Information commissioner’s post is a responsible position and  H N Krishna should be immediately removed from the post, he added. Progressive thinkers P Mallesh, N S Raghunath, former syndicate member N S Gopinath, theatre artiste K Muddukrishna, litterateur Prof K S Bhagwan, former mayor Ananthu and others participated in the rally.

The rally would pass through Mandya, Maddur, Ramanagar and stop at Bidadi for the night and would reach Freedom Park in Bangalore on September 8 at 11.30 am.
